Skip to content
Canadian Immigration Dashboard [ CID ]
Perspective API

Toxicity Scores & Embeddings

Search and explore comments with their Perspective API toxicity/prosocial scores alongside AI sentiment labels.

Communalytic | Toxicity & prosocial scores, embeddings, and clusters generated via Communalytic (Social Media Lab, Toronto Metropolitan University) using Google's Perspective API.
Toxicity Scored
55,769
9.3% of 596,542 total
Prosocial Scored
54,229
Embeddings
55,418
403 clusters
Avg Tox / Con
0.245 / 0.328

Summary Charts

click to expand

All 13 Dimensions

Score Distribution

Scored: 55,769
Unscored: 596,542 remaining
9.3% complete
{# Expects: explorer_rows, explorer_total, explorer_pages, current_page, page_range, filter_opts, f_q, f_polarity, f_tox_min, f_tox_max, f_sort, f_cluster, f_scope, explorer_reset_url #}

Comment Explorer

Browse comments with toxicity & constructive scores. Filter by keyword, polarity, toxicity range, or cluster.

Search & Filter

Search comment text, filter by category or toxicity level
Active: "It’s about control of our …" 235 comments · Page 10 of 10
Guys, they didn't "lose control". It works exactly as the federal government intended.
Guys, they didn't "lose control". It works exactly as the federal government intended.
Identity Attack0.0026083488
Insult0.009089886
Profanity0.010894509
Threat0.0062849927
Severe Toxicity0.0006055832
Low Tox 0.01419965 Low Con 0.265 Policy_Critique
Feb 27, 2026 1 likes BATRA’S BURNING QUESTIONS: Canada’s absent …
We can do our own taxes .It’s all about control
We can do our own taxes .It’s all about control
Identity Attack0.0016371552
Insult0.008918885
Profanity0.010655395
Threat0.006051969
Severe Toxicity0.000603199
Low Tox 0.0131943645 Moderate Con 0.31 Unverified_Claim
Jan 6, 2026 4 likes New rules, regulations take effect …
Why isn’t the aiming that message at Doug Ford and Danielle Smith? They control healthcare in their provinces
Why isn’t the aiming that message at Doug Ford and Danielle Smith? They control healthcare in their provinces
Identity Attack0.002552852
Insult0.009108886
Profanity0.009664777
Threat0.0059516393
Severe Toxicity0.0005054474
Low Tox 0.012754552 Low Con 0.294 Policy_Critique
Feb 24, 2026 'We do know that there's …
IIRC saying they are "regaining control", meaning they didn't have control in the first place.
IIRC saying they are "regaining control", meaning they didn't have control in the first place.
Identity Attack0.002192123
Insult0.008234881
Profanity0.010450439
Threat0.006375613
Severe Toxicity0.0005221367
Low Tox 0.012503231 Low Con 0.266 Policy_Critique
Jan 15, 2026 7 likes 2.9 million Canadian temporary visas …
Immigration is out of control ! It is 2025 , the year isn’t even half over and they have already brought in almost 1 million mostly Indians . You need to get your facts straight …
Immigration is out of control ! It is 2025 , the year isn’t even half over and they have already brought in almost 1 million mostly Indians . You need to get your facts straight .
Identity Attack0.014597976
Insult0.0013591878
Profanity0.00011599752
Threat0.00016591376
Severe Toxicity0.000005316609
Low Tox 0.012240606
Jun 26, 2025
I’m a traffic control person and I get brampton sites pretty often. 3 out 5 of them dont slow down on construction sites (usually truck driver)
I’m a traffic control person and I get brampton sites pretty often. 3 out 5 of them dont slow down on construction sites (usually truck driver)
Identity Attack0.0019793853
Insult0.007360875
Profanity0.01086035
Threat0.007068211
Severe Toxicity0.0007677078
Low Tox 0.010743983 Constructive 0.504 Personal_Narrative
Jan 27, 2026 Inside Canada's Indian Invasion...
Under the Liberals, Canada is not a good place to live now! The April 28th election must remove the Liberal / Chinese control in Canada.
Under the Liberals, Canada is not a good place to live now! The April 28th election must remove the Liberal / Chinese control in Canada.
Identity Attack0.002680398
Insult0.0019505017
Profanity0.000066473294
Threat0.00015141239
Severe Toxicity0.0000030739036
Low Tox 0.007901065
Apr 14, 2025 1 likes
The TDS on here is out of control. 😂😂😂
The TDS on here is out of control. 😂😂😂
Identity Attack0.0000803828
Insult0.00038388837
Profanity0.000030506504
Threat0.000030768526
Severe Toxicity0.0000018295998
Low Tox 0.0008731293 Meta_Commentary
Dec 9, 2025
Losing millions in immigration will actually help Canada after over-inflating immigration. It will better control the housing crisis, food crisis, healthcare crisis. Pausing immigration so the numbers correct itself will fix a lot of the …
Losing millions in immigration will actually help Canada after over-inflating immigration. It will better control the housing crisis, food crisis, healthcare crisis. Pausing immigration so the numbers correct itself will fix a lot of the issues Canadians face.
Identity Attack0.00016129999
Insult0.00020965506
Profanity0.0000160642
Threat0.000034526518
Severe Toxicity0.0000022098052
Low Tox 0.0006739027
Apr 20, 2025 6 likes
Canadian are going through same as American people hegfund buy up all home apartments, they control prices. 17:19
Canadian are going through same as American people hegfund buy up all home apartments, they control prices. 17:19
Identity Attack0.00010948801
Insult0.00016959144
Profanity0.000021112925
Threat0.0000283201
Severe Toxicity0.0000022433012
Low Tox 0.00046377254 Economic_Argument
Apr 17, 2025

Perspective API Dimensions Reference

13 dimensions explained

Toxic (6)

Toxicity
— Rude, disrespectful, or unreasonable
Severe Toxicity
— Very hateful or aggressive
Identity Attack
— Targeting race, religion, gender, etc.
Insult
— Inflammatory or provocative language
Profanity
— Swear words or obscene language
Threat
— Intention to inflict pain or violence

Prosocial (7)

Affinity
— Agreement or shared understanding
Compassion
— Concern for others' wellbeing
Curiosity
— Desire to learn or understand more
Nuance
— Acknowledges complexity or multiple perspectives
Personal Story
— Shares personal experience
Reasoning
— Evidence-based or logical argumentation
Respect
— Politeness and consideration for others
Data sources: comment_perspective_scores, comment_embeddings, and view_comment_sentiment · Scores are probability values (0–1) from Google's Perspective API via Communalytic.